TensorUsage
Enum to declare tensor's usage. By default, the tensor shall all be of multi-dimensional usage, which creates non-structured data arrays. Such a tensor observes the conventional definition of tensors in linear algebra, where the values it contains are non-structured.
Tensors of other usage types extend the use scenarios of tensor objects, from conventional mathematics and physics applications to a general abstraction of any structured data in Spatial SecureMR. Here, we say the data of these tensors with extended definitions are "structured", as values at different indices inside the tensor are assigned with different meanings and subject to pre-determined limitations.
For example, a tensor of POINT usage will have two/three values per element: meaning the X, Y (and Z) components respective. Similarly, a tensor of COLOR usage will have three/four values per element instead, storing R, G, B (and A) components.
NOTE Nevertheless, you are not suppose to use these enums directly. Instead, you will find the subclasses of InitInfo handy.

Entries
Multi-dimensional usage, i.e., tensors under mathematics or physics definition
A scalar array, the data in the tensor will be regarded as an array of scalars, useful for indices, counters, etc.
The data in the tensor shall be interpreted as numerical values, but as a structured scene graph.
